【题目】 William and Tim were going into morning assembly along with all the other students. Tim looked around him for signs of trouble, but everything seemed normal. Mrs Barrow began with the Student of the Year projects.

"There are a lot of excellent projects," she said. "I'll mention just a few of them today." She paused for a moment "Claire and Lynn, can you please stand up?"

Lynn stood up, but turned red and stared at the floor.

"Claire and Lynn have started a Reading for Kids project. Good work, Claire and Lynn. Jenny, can you stand up, please?" Jenny stood up. "Now, all those pictures and items of artwork on display around the school are part of Jenny’s Arkwright project. Well done, Jenny! "

"William", said Mrs Barrow. "Where are you, William?'

William opened his eyes and stood up.

"William is helping old people in the community through his Citizens' Aid project. A truly excellent idea. I wish everyone would care for others the way William does. "

"Tim Norris," said Mrs Barrow. Her voice was serious. Her expression was serious. "Will you please come to the stage?" Tim's heart pounded. He looked at William but William looked away. Tim stood up and walked to the front of the school hall. The other children stared at him as he climbed the steps of the stage and walked to where Mrs Barrow was standing.

Tim looked down at his trainers. They had mud and grass on them. He wanted to hide his feet.

"I want everyone here to take note of what Tim has done," said Mrs Barrow. "In just a very short space of time, he has cleaned up the whole school as part of his KAT project. Now every class has a KAT person and the school is litter-free. Thank you, Tim. "

All the students and staff clapped their hands. Tim gave a huge sigh of relief.

Mr Graham was late for class that morning. By the time he arrived, the children were laughing and talking at the top of their voices. Mr Graham looked pale and upset. The students fell silent immediately.

They knew something was wrong.

"Tim," said MR Graham, "could you please go to Mrs Barrow's office. Go right now," he said.

【题目】 Everything starts as a dream, a thought or an image in your mind, but this is just the first step to success. You should take action. If you stay there, you will enjoy your dream. One day you will see that you are standing still, like a person watching a beautiful and inspiring movie over and over again, but not going out to the real world to create and live what he or she has seen in the movie.

Are you waiting for some miracles (奇迹) to change your life? Sometimes, miracles do happen, but why not make the miracles happen? By taking part in its creation; by planning, watching, expecting, and acting, you can help the miracles happen.

For most people, it looks like a difficult step, because they don’t know where to start and what to do. Don’t be afraid of the “action” part. You can take action that takes you closer to your goals, even if you don’t have enough money, time, or the proper abilities.

The people who succeed are always those who would take action. They think, plan, read, and look around them to see open doors, then take action. This has to do with every area of life, including relationships, work, material success, self-improvement and spiritual growth.

Sometimes, you might find yourself pushed into an open door, toward success. But in most situations, you will see the door and notice it, but you need the “action part” of opening it, passing through it, and doing things to make the goal come true.

Don’t wait for the opportunity to come. Create the opportunity. Believe that it is already here, and improve yourself for it, so that when it appears, you can hold it, and make the most of it.
